| Editorial Reviews:
Product Description Designed to replace 50R20 lamps for reduced energy costs. Bright white light. Brass bases resist vibration and corrosion. 4,000 average life hours when used on a 120 Volt line. 3-1/4"L overall.

Good price and Long Life too July 25, 2010 Nutmeg I just purchased these halogen floods for my new range hood which came without any bulbs. I like the 130 volt rating for longer life when operated at 120 volts. I needed 2 but purchased 4 for the free shipping and for spares. They are great so far and cost less than purchasing 120 volt bulbs locally (130 volt rated bulbs not locally available).
inconsistent quality? February 25, 2008 sumthin sumthin 5 out of 5 found this review helpful
My first bulb was installed in Dec 2007, and is still running fine as of Feb 2008. However, I installed my second bulb on a different socket (on the same circuit) 2 weeks ago, and it has already burned out. I called Feit to complain, and they insisted that they could not help me out because my bulbs don't have the model number printed on their base. After offering to read off the model number that's printed on my box (ie, 50PAR20/QFL), they were very reluctant to accept this info. Strange. Anyway, after ~10 mins or so, they eventually stated that they'll ship me a replacement, and that it should arrive in 4 to 6 weeks. Yup, 4 to 6 weeks! A Final Warning: Feit informed me that they don't normally offer replacements for bulbs purchased through online vendors. I guess I should consider myself lucky?
